Slate Roof Replacement in Fredericksburg, VA
Slate roof replacement services involve removing an existing slate roof and installing a new slate roofing system to restore the durability and aesthetic appeal of a property. This service covers a variety of projects, including replacing aging or damaged slate shingles, upgrading roofs for improved weather resistance, or restoring historic buildings with original slate materials. Homeowners typically seek this service when their current slate roof shows signs of extensive wear, such as cracked or missing slates, leaks, or structural deterioration, and want a long-lasting solution that preserves the character of their property.
Before requesting slate roof replacement, property owners should understand the importance of proper assessment to determine the condition of the existing roof and the compatibility of new slate materials. It is also helpful to consider the style and color options available to match the building’s architecture. Since slate roofing can be a significant investment, understanding the scope of work, including potential structural repairs and the expected lifespan of the new roof, can assist in making informed decisions. Clear communication about project goals and maintenance expectations can ensure the replacement process aligns with property owners’ needs.

Slate Roof Replacement Questions
What are the signs that a slate roof needs replacement? Signs include cracked or broken slates, excessive moss or algae growth, and visible leaks or water damage inside the property.
How long does a slate roof replacement typically take? The duration depends on the size and complexity of the project, but it generally ranges from a few days to a week.
What types of properties benefit from slate roof replacement? Residential homes, historic buildings, and commercial properties with existing slate roofing are common projects for replacement services.
What should property owners consider before replacing a slate roof? Factors include the roof’s age, condition, and compatibility with existing structures, as well as the overall aesthetic and durability goals.
